We use Essential Letters and Sounds to teach early reading in Reception. We plan carefully to ensure that lessons are focused to what the children need and are followed up by a selection of creative and immersive activities to help embed the children's learning.

Children learn to read letters or groups of letters by saying the sounds they represent. Pronounce the sounds as you would say them within a word. Make sure you don’t add ‘uh’ onto the end, so for ‘m’ say ‘mm’ not ‘muh’ and for ‘l’ say ‘ull’ not ‘luh’. The below video gives you all 44 sounds in English.
